Description

The barn and adjoining outbuildings located immediately south of Tregonebris Old Manor House date from the early to mid-19th century. Constructed of granite rubble with granite dressings, the buildings feature scantle slate roofs. The barn has a half-hipped roof, while the adjoining structures have hipped roofs, except for the small front and rear wings, which have corrugated iron roofs. A back chimney is positioned over the front end of the right wing.

The overall layout is L-shaped, with a small wing at right angles in front of the middle of the barn and another behind the left side. A single-storey range, built in two phases, projects in front of the barn on the right; the section next to the barn is likely a washhouse. The barn originally contained two threshing floors with opposing loading and winnowing doorways, along with rear doorways that are nearly level with the bank at the back.

The exterior features a two-storey barn with single-storey extensions and a four-window south front. A central gabled-ended wagon house wing is located in front of what is likely the original wagon doorway. Most original openings remain, although the first-floor loading doorways have been partly blocked and fitted with windows. There are old ledged doors and some possibly original two-light windows; the ground floor left-hand window has bars, while the first-floor window on the right has shutters. The rear includes two shuttered windows. On the left side, there is a single-storey wing with a doorway on its right, and on the right side, a wing projects in front, featuring two doorways in its left-hand wall and two original 12-pane two-light casements in its right-hand wall, overlooking the front garden of Tregonebris Cottage. The interior has not been inspected.
